Document Description
2001-110 Zoning Amendment, Revised Conditional Use Permit and Addendum to the Environmental Impact Report (EIR) for Calaveras Asbestos Monofill, Inc. (CAM) to make certain changes (including local land use regulation designation changes and use permit modifications to clarify types and methods of waste handling and disposal) to permitted disposal operations in the former asbestos mine pit located in Southwestern Calaveras County.
